稀土元素对KNdP4O12激光晶体的影响
Effects of rare-earth elements on KNdP4O12 laser crystals
摘要
用蒸发溶液法从磷酸溶液中生长出14种KNd0.9Ln0.1P4O12晶体(其中Ln=La、Ce、Pr、Sm、Eu、Gd、Tb、Dy、Ho、Er、Tm、Yb、Lu或Y)。测定了它们的晶体结构、红外光谱、吸收光谱、荧光光谱和荧光寿命,计算了晶格常数,观察到掺入Ln3+后对KNdP4O12晶体的影响。
Abstract
KNd0.9Ln0.1P4O12 crystals (Ln=La, Ce, Pr, Sm, Eu, Gd, Tb, Dy, Ho, Er, Tim, Yb, Lu or Y) have been grown by evaporation solution methed. Their X-ray diffraction patterns, infrared, absorption, fluorescent spectra and fluorescent lifetime have been measured. The effects of Ln3+ on KNdP4O12 have been observed.
